*M**edovriddhi(Overweight) by Dr. *Dr Rajeshwari Singh

Overweight is a state in which weight exceeds a standard based on
height; Obesity is a condition of excessive fatness, either generalized
or localized. In most people overweight and obesity tend to parallel
each other. Overweight is a condition which can be correlated with
medovriddhi.

Etymology of Medovriddhi:

The word "Medovriddhi" is the combination of two Sanskrit words "Meda"
and "Vriddhi".
The word "Meda" means   - Fat of Body (Sanskrit eng dictionary)
The word "Vriddhi" literally means the growth, increase etc.

Concept of Meda:

Ayurveda considers that the human body is made up of seven body tissues
(saptha dhatu) and medodhatu is one among them.

Etiology:

The causative factors (nidana) known for a disease can be classified
under four broad categories:

A. Dietetic factors (Aharatmaka)
B. Physical activities & practices  (Viharatmaka)
C. Psychological causes  (Manasa vyaparatmaka)
D. Others

These are tabulated as follows -

*
**A. * *Dietetic factors (Aharatmaka Nidana): *

Excessive usage of food items (dravya) having homologous properties help
in progressive increase of the tissues (dhatu) and the process becomes
reversible in case of heterogeneous ones. Few dietetic factors are as
follows:

1. Over eating  (Ati Sampurana)
2. Highly nutritious intake (Santarpana)
3. Food intake before the digestion of the previous meal (Adhyasana)
4. Excessive Consumption of Heavy food  (Guru Ahara sevana)
5. Excessive Consumption of  Sweet food (Madhura Ahara sevana)
6. Excessive Consumption of  Cold food (Sita Ahara sevana)
7. Kapha increasing food intake (Snigdha Ahara sevana)
8. Fresh food & grain  (Navanna sevana)
9. Fresh alcoholic preparation (Nava Madya Sevana)
10. Domestic animals meat & soups  (Gramya Rasa Sevana)
11. Meat intake (Mamsa Sevana)
12. Milk Products  (Payasa Vikara Sevana)
13. Curd (Dadhi Sevana)
14. Ghee (Sarpi Sevana)
15. Sugar cane preparations  (Ikshu Vikara Sevana)
16. Jaggery preparation  (Guda Vikara Sevana)
17. Rice (Sali Sevana)
18. Water intake immediately after meal  (Bhojanotara Jal-pana)

*
**B.**Causes due to physical activities & practices (Vihara  Parak Hetu):*

Physical activities & practices are termed as Vihar.

*
1. Lack of physical exercise  (Avyayama)
2. Lack of sexual act (Avyavaya)
3. Day time sleep  (Divaswapna)
4. Luxurious sitting for long time (Asana Sukha)
5. Bath after meal (Bhojanottar Snana)
6. After meal sleep  (Bhojanotar Nidra)

**C.**Psychological causes  or Manasika Nidana
The psychological causes for overweight/obesity, according to various
Acharyas are listed as below-*

1. Forever cheerfulness  (Harshnityatvata)
2. Free from anxiety  (Achintan)
3. Relaxation from tension  (Manasonivritti)
4. Sight of beloved things  (Priyadarsana)

*
**D.** MISCELLANEOUS CAUSES *

1. Ama (accumulation of toxins in the body)
2. Administration of oily & sweet enema which is nourishing in property
  (Snigdha Madhura Basti Sevana)
3. Massaging using oil  (Tailabhyanga)
4. Heredity factors (Bijadoshasvabhavata)

*
**Treatment (Cikitsa) *

Thus, the treatment has got 5 divisions:

Avoiding the causes : (Nidan Parivarjana) (S. S.U.1/25)

It very clearly advocates that the restriction and avoiding the root
cause is the foremost line of treatment to curb the progression of the
disease.

External purification (Bahya Sansodhana)

It includes body massage with some specific herbs powder (Ruksa
Udvartana). In obese persons, it removes the foetid odour & restricts
the excessive sweating & alleviates the aggravated doshas by function.

Internal purification (Abhyantara Sansodhana)

Panchakarma procedure i.e. Vamana (emesis), Virechana (purgation), Nasya
(nasal drops), Anuvasana Basti ( oil enema of herbs) and Niruha basti
(decoction enema of herbs).

Pacifying Therapy (Sansamana Therapy)

Dry, warm & strong basti, dry massage, night awakening, sexual act,
physical activity & mental exertion should be undertaken in gradual
manner. Guduchi, BhadraMusta, Triphala, Takrarista, Maksika, Vidamgadi
Lauha, Bilwadi Panchmula & Shilajatu with Agnimanth Swarasa should be
taken (C.S.Su.21).

Dietary regimen (Pathyapathya Ahara)-

Pathya --apathya also play an important role in the treatment of
Medovriddhi

Cereal grains (Suka Dhanya): one year old cereals (puran dhanya) should
be taken.
Take only one carbohydrate source at a time i.e. potato / rice/ wheat
should be taken only one in a single meal.
Pulses (Sami Dhanya) : Vigna Catiang(Rajamasa), Phaseolus aureus
(mudga), Ervum lens, Cajanas indicus(Masur), Cajanas indicus (Adhaki)
and Cicer Arientum (Canaka) should be taken but  Phaseolus mungo (Masa)
should be avoided.
Vegetables (Saka Varga): Leafy vegetables can be taken as salad.
Take one plate of salad without dressing, before every meal
Fruits (Phala Varga): Gooseberry, Piper nigrum, Piper longum and Aegle
mermelos should be taken but excessive sweet (madhur rasa) should be
avoided. Banana and mango should be taken less.
Fruits should be taken instead of fruit juices.
Liquid (Drava Varga): Honey, Honey with water, lukewarm water, Lemon
water should be taken but dairy products should be avoided.
Cold drinks and excessive caffeine should be avoided especially
immediately after meals.
Eat slowly and mindfully (Have a set time for every meal and while
eating concentrate on the food without indulging in any other things)
Spices like Fenugreek, Coriander, Cumin, Black pepper, turmeric, dil
seeds, dry ginger, garlic can be used for cooking.
Avoid excess spices, white bread, oily food or deep fried foods, excess
sugar, salt, cold drinks.
Replace the old cheese with fresh cottage cheese
Take freshly cooked warm home made foods.

Panchakarma is the best choice but require minimum 7 days.

Panchakarma includes the 5 treatments mainly as the word itself suggest
pancha means 5 & Karma means treatments or actions.

The 5 treatments are emesis, purgation, oil enema, decoction enema,
nasal drops/ sinus cleansing.

The treatment among these is selected as per the patients ailments,
prakruti / body type, season and many other factors.

The panchakarma treatments includes the shodhana or purificatory
treatments  and also has many other treatments as preparatory procedures
and post treatment procedures.

The preparatory procedure is to prepare the body for elimination of
toxins by any of the 5 karmas so that the body can tolerate it.

The preparatory procedures includes oil massage, powder massage,
different types of steaming etc.

And the post treatment procedures and herbal internal medicines will be
given to restore the effect of the treatment.

Thus the whole Panchakarma treatment is beneficial for a diseased to
cure his disease and also for a healthy person to maintain his health.

It detoxifies and rejuvenates the body.

Udvartanam is a powder massage or gel scrub massage ( customized as per
the patients) particularly for cellulites management. This treatment
helps to reduce fat or cellulites with taking care of skin tone. The
usual weight reduction results in stretch marks and loss of skin tone
and this is taken care by the Udvarthanam.

Swedanam is the steaming which helps in expelling toxins through skin pores

Karshan basti is a particular herbal decoction enema specific  for the
weight reduction.
